re PR libstdc++/58839 (dereferencing void* in shared_ptr(unique_ptr&& u) constructor)
authorJonathan Wakely <jwakely.gcc@gmail.com>
Tue, 29 Oct 2013 21:33:29 +0000 (21:33 +0000)
committerJonathan Wakely <redi@gcc.gnu.org>
Tue, 29 Oct 2013 21:33:29 +0000 (21:33 +0000)
PR libstdc++/58839
* include/bits/shared_ptr_base.h
(__shared_ptr<T>::__shared_ptr(unique_ptr<U,D>&&)): Only use addressof
when unique_ptr<U,D>::pointer is not a built-in pointer type.
* testsuite/20_util/shared_ptr/cons/58839.cc: New.
* testsuite/20_util/enable_shared_from_this/members/assign.cc: New.
* testsuite/20_util/enable_shared_from_this/members/unique_ptr.cc: New.
